A voir également:
- Conversion min et sec sous Excel
- Liste déroulante excel - Guide
- Si et excel - Guide
- Word et excel gratuit - Guide
- Formule excel - Guide
- Aller à la ligne excel - Guide
4 réponses
tontong
Messages postés
2549
Date d'inscription
mercredi 3 février 2010
Statut
Membre
Dernière intervention
23 avril 2024
1 054
7 oct. 2010 à 12:29
7 oct. 2010 à 12:29
Bonjour à Vaucluse, bonjour à Nizett' ;-)
J'étais sur la voie des "Substitue" avec les mêmes écueils
=(0&":"&(SUBSTITUE(SUBSTITUE(SUBSTITUE(A5;" ";"";1);"s";"";1);"m";":";1)))*1
Une partie de la formule peut être supprimée s'il n'y a jamais d'espace dans le texte.
J'étais sur la voie des "Substitue" avec les mêmes écueils
=(0&":"&(SUBSTITUE(SUBSTITUE(SUBSTITUE(A5;" ";"";1);"s";"";1);"m";":";1)))*1
Une partie de la formule peut être supprimée s'il n'y a jamais d'espace dans le texte.
Vaucluse
Messages postés
26496
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
1 avril 2022
6 397
7 oct. 2010 à 11:54
7 oct. 2010 à 11:54
Bonjour
la formule ci dessous pour une valeur en A1 sous réserve que les secondes soient toujours affichées avec deux chiffres et donc commencent par 0 si inférieur à 10 et si il n'y a pas d'heure dans vos valeurs
Si ce n'est pas le cas revenez, c'est un peu plus complexe !
=("0:"&(GAUCHE(A1;TROUVE("m";A1)-1)&":"&STXT(A1;TROUVE("m";A1)+1;2)))*1
Formatez la cellule résultat en format Heure si vous voulez la forme 00:00:00
ou en format personnalisé et entrez
mm:aa
si vous ne voulez que les minutes et secondes.
A vous lire si besoin
Crdlmnt
la formule ci dessous pour une valeur en A1 sous réserve que les secondes soient toujours affichées avec deux chiffres et donc commencent par 0 si inférieur à 10 et si il n'y a pas d'heure dans vos valeurs
Si ce n'est pas le cas revenez, c'est un peu plus complexe !
=("0:"&(GAUCHE(A1;TROUVE("m";A1)-1)&":"&STXT(A1;TROUVE("m";A1)+1;2)))*1
Formatez la cellule résultat en format Heure si vous voulez la forme 00:00:00
ou en format personnalisé et entrez
mm:aa
si vous ne voulez que les minutes et secondes.
A vous lire si besoin
Crdlmnt
Bonjour Vaucluse et merci pour ta réponse.
Malheureusement pour moi, lorsque les secondes sont inférieures à 10, elle ne comporte qu'un seul chiffre.
Parallèlement à ma demande sur le forum, j'ai fait une demande à l'administrateur afin qu'il revoit son fichier car celui-ci doit me servir pour ensuite faire des TCD et je ne souhaite pas passer 1H tous les deux jours à remettre celui-ci en forme.
On verra la suite...
Mais si jamais tu as une autre idée de formule, je prends bien evidemment.
Cordialement,
Malheureusement pour moi, lorsque les secondes sont inférieures à 10, elle ne comporte qu'un seul chiffre.
Parallèlement à ma demande sur le forum, j'ai fait une demande à l'administrateur afin qu'il revoit son fichier car celui-ci doit me servir pour ensuite faire des TCD et je ne souhaite pas passer 1H tous les deux jours à remettre celui-ci en forme.
On verra la suite...
Mais si jamais tu as une autre idée de formule, je prends bien evidemment.
Cordialement,
Vaucluse
Messages postés
26496
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
1 avril 2022
6 397
7 oct. 2010 à 12:33
7 oct. 2010 à 12:33
Je regarde la formule complète ce ne doit pas être aussi compliqué que ça!
en attendant une solution mal taillée qui permet de transformer non pas en mn seconde mais qui passe les mn en heures... je ne sais pas selon ce que tu veux faire si ça te convient
Soit: sélectionner le champ
édition / remplacer:
m par :
remplacer tout
ensuite
s par rien
remplacer tout
le 4m10s devient 04:10 et un 4m7s devient 04:07
regardes si ça convient à tes graphiques?
crdlmnt
en attendant une solution mal taillée qui permet de transformer non pas en mn seconde mais qui passe les mn en heures... je ne sais pas selon ce que tu veux faire si ça te convient
Soit: sélectionner le champ
édition / remplacer:
m par :
remplacer tout
ensuite
s par rien
remplacer tout
le 4m10s devient 04:10 et un 4m7s devient 04:07
regardes si ça convient à tes graphiques?
crdlmnt